You: A Geography Genius? (NAPSA)—Are you clever when it comes to knowing about other countries? Take this little test and name the city and country that are described to test your geographyskills. The capital of this country was founded by Christopher Columbus’ brother Bartholomew in 1496, and named a Cultural Capital by the American Capital of Culture organization in 2010. This first city of the New World served as the center of exploration to the Americas and is now a thriving metropolis overflowing with vibrant culture andrich history. The oldest part of the city is knownas the Colonial City. There, visitors can explore the Alcazar de Coln, Bartholomew Columbus’ home, and also the first cathedral, university and hospital of the Americas. Historic buildings rest along cobblestone streets that Spanish conquistadors once strolled. The legendary city has a wealth of museums, monuments and restaurants, set among the larger city’s modern amenities such as the new Metro transportation sys- tem, state-of-the-art cruise ship terminals, savory cuisine, unique shopping, architecture and more. Resting on the Caribbean Sea, the mystery city is a sophisticated center of commerce with 2.3 mil- lion residents, dozens of worldclass museums, opera, arts and historic sites, including the Columbus Lighthouse, where Christopher Columbus’ remainsare said to be. Is this city (a) San Pedro Garza Garcia, Mexico (b) Santo Domingo, Dominican Republic or (c) San Juan, Puerto Rico? Answer The answer is (b) Santo Domingo, Dominican Republic, the second largest country in the Caribbean.
